Partnership Announcement: Moreton City Excelsior

In an exciting move for Queensland football, two of the region’s most prominent clubs, Albany Creek Excelsior Football Club (ACE) and Moreton Bay United Football Club (MBU), have officially merged to create Moreton City Excelsior Football Club. This strategic decision, which had been formally endorsed by Football Queensland, signals the start of a new era of football excellence for the city of Moreton Bay. The combination of ACE and MBU brings together a rich history of success, passion and dedication. The well-known youth development philosophy of these two clubs will be adapted and delivered to players of all ages and skill levels by Moreton City Excelsiors' new expanded technical team. By merging the former clubs’ strengths, resources and expertise, Moreton City Excelsior will offer its members a more substantial football club that will deliver an improved experience while ensuring a sustainable operational model for the future. The result will be a unified entity that offers a multitude of pathways through Senior, Youth and Community programs.  

Ben Parkin, Chairman of Moreton Bay United, expressed his enthusiasm for the merger.  

"The history of these two clubs will always remain at the heart of the new club, and I am really excited about what the future looks like for Moreton City Excelsior." This sentiment is echoed by ACE President Tony Dooley, who emphasized the extensive and collaborative work that went into this union, adding that it will undoubtedly benefit the members of both clubs. 

With the merger set to take effect from 2024, Moreton City Excelsior will continue to field senior teams in the National Premier League (NPL) Queensland and Football Queensland Premier League (FQPL) competitions. This ensures that the club remains a dominant force in Queensland football, just as its predecessor clubs were individually.
